Description

Director of Outpatient Therapy - [Omaha, NE]

Blue Stone Therapy is seeking a Director of Outpatient Therapy (DOT) to oversee outpatient rehabilitation services at [Espirt Whispering Ridge] in [Omaha, NE].

This leadership role is responsible for the daily operations, clinical oversight, staffing strategy, and performance management of the outpatient therapy department. The Director of Outpatient Therapy ensures the delivery of high-quality rehabilitation services while driving operational efficiency, patient satisfaction, and measurable outcomes.

This position provides direct patient care as needed and is accountable for achieving productivity and utilization standards.

What You'll Do
  • Lead daily outpatient therapy operations, including staffing, scheduling, and utilization
  • Provide clinical oversight related to case management, care planning, and appropriate therapy delivery
  • Support onboarding, accountability, coaching, and performance management of therapy team members
  • Maintain productivity standards while providing direct patient care as required
  • Ensure compliance with company policies, regulatory requirements, and professional standards
  • Collaborate with leadership to strengthen program development and service growth
  • Promote quality improvement initiatives and strong patient outcomes
  • Foster a positive team culture aligned with Blue Stone Therapy's purpose and core values


Requirements

What You Bring
  • Graduate of an accredited program in Physical Therapy, Occupational Therapy, Speech Language Pathology, Physical Therapy Assistant, or Occupational Therapy Assistant
  • Current therapy license (PT, OT, SLP, PTA, or COTA) or eligibility for licensure in applicable state
  • Minimum of one (1) year of clinical experience in a therapy services role
  • Strong leadership, organizational, and communication skills
  • Ability to manage staffing, scheduling, and operational performance
  • Experience in outpatient therapy settings preferred
  • Experience with NetHealth or electronic medical record systems preferred
